Acadia Healthcare Company, Inc. (NASDAQ: ACHC) stands out in the healthcare sector with a notable focus on behavioral healthcare services across the U.S. and Puerto Rico. With a market capitalization of $1.19 billion, Acadia is not just a player in the medical care facilities industry but a vital contributor to addressing critical mental health needs. The company’s diverse portfolio includes acute inpatient psychiatric facilities, specialty treatment centers, and outpatient services, positioning it as a comprehensive provider in the behavioral healthcare landscape.

Currently trading at $13.21, Acadia’s stock reflects a modest decline of 0.02% recently, with a price change of -$0.23. The stock’s 52-week range highlights significant volatility, with lows at $11.68 and highs reaching $45.06. This wide range suggests both challenges and opportunities for potential investors.

Valuation metrics provide a mixed picture. The forward P/E ratio stands at an attractive 7.59, which may appeal to value investors searching for growth at a reasonable price. However, the absence of trailing P/E, PEG, price/book, and price/sales ratios complicates a full valuation assessment. The lack of these metrics suggests potential concerns or complexities in financial reporting or profitability that investors should explore further.

Performance indicators reveal a company experiencing growth but facing financial hurdles. Revenue has climbed by 4.40%, a positive sign amid an increasingly competitive market. Yet, the absence of net income data and a negative free cash flow of approximately $361.6 million could raise red flags, suggesting liquidity issues or heavy reinvestment costs. With an EPS of 1.16 and a return on equity of 3.69%, Acadia demonstrates profitability, albeit at lower margins. The absence of a dividend yield and a payout ratio of 0% further implies that Acadia is in a growth phase, potentially reinvesting earnings back into business expansion.

Analyst sentiment reflects cautious optimism. With seven buy ratings, six holds, and one sell, the consensus leans slightly bullish. The target price range of $13.00 to $27.00 indicates a potential upside of 44.37% from the current price, a compelling figure for risk-tolerant investors seeking growth opportunities. The average target price sits at $19.07, suggesting room for appreciation if the company can navigate its financial challenges.

Technical indicators present a bearish short-term outlook. The stock’s 50-day moving average is $14.36, while the 200-day moving average is significantly higher at $20.46, indicating a downward trend. The relative strength index (RSI) of 28.19 suggests the stock is oversold, potentially signaling a buying opportunity if the broader market dynamics align favorably. The MACD and signal line both being negative further reinforce the cautious technical sentiment.
